/*
|
|
lib/calib.c
|
|
functions for setting calibration
|
|
|
|

#define _GNU_SOURCE
|
|
|
|
#include <stdlib.h>
|
|
#include <stdio.h>
|
|
#include <string.h>
|
|
#include <comedilib.h>
|
|
#include <libinternal.h>
|
|
|
|
static int check_cal_file( comedi_t *dev, struct calibration_file_contents *parsed_file )
|
|
{
|
|
if( strcmp( comedi_get_driver_name( dev ), parsed_file->driver_name ) )
|
|
{
|
|
COMEDILIB_DEBUG( 3, "driver name does not match '%s' from calibration file\n",
|
|
parsed_file->driver_name );
|
|
return -1;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
if( strcmp( comedi_get_board_name( dev ), parsed_file->board_name ) )
|
|
{
|
|
COMEDILIB_DEBUG( 3, "board name does not match '%s' from calibration file\n",
|
|
parsed_file->board_name );
|
|
return -1;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return 0;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
static inline int valid_channel( struct calibration_file_contents *parsed_file,
|
|
unsigned int cal_index, unsigned int channel )
|
|
{
|
|
int num_channels, i;
|
|
|
|
num_channels = parsed_file->calibrations[ cal_index ].num_channels;
|
|
if( num_channels == 0 ) return 1;
|
|
for( i = 0; i < num_channels; i++ )
|
|
{
|
|
if( parsed_file->calibrations[ cal_index ].channels[ i ] == channel )
|
|
return 1;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return 0;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
static inline int valid_range( struct calibration_file_contents *parsed_file,
|
|
unsigned int cal_index, unsigned int range )
|
|
{
|
|
int num_ranges, i;
|
|
|
|
num_ranges = parsed_file->calibrations[ cal_index ].num_ranges;
|
|
if( num_ranges == 0 ) return 1;
|
|
for( i = 0; i < num_ranges; i++ )
|
|
{
|
|
if( parsed_file->calibrations[ cal_index ].ranges[ i ] == range )
|
|
return 1;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return 0;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
static inline int valid_aref( struct calibration_file_contents *parsed_file,
|
|
unsigned int cal_index, unsigned int aref )
|
|
{
|
|
int num_arefs, i;
|
|
|
|
num_arefs = parsed_file->calibrations[ cal_index ].num_arefs;
|
|
if( num_arefs == 0 ) return 1;
|
|
for( i = 0; i < num_arefs; i++ )
|
|
{
|
|
if( parsed_file->calibrations[ cal_index ].arefs[ i ] == aref )
|
|
return 1;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return 0;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
static int find_calibration( struct calibration_file_contents *parsed_file,
|
|
unsigned int subdev, unsigned int channel, unsigned int range, unsigned int aref )
|
|
{
|
|
int num_cals, i;
|
|
|
|
num_cals = parsed_file->num_calibrations;
|
|
|
|
for( i = 0; i < num_cals; i++ )
|
|
{
|
|
if( parsed_file->calibrations[ i ].subdevice != subdev ) continue;
|
|
if( valid_range( parsed_file, i, range ) == 0 ) continue;
|
|
if( valid_channel( parsed_file, i, channel ) == 0 ) continue;
|
|
if( valid_aref( parsed_file, i, aref ) == 0 ) continue;
|
|
break;
|
|
}
|
|
if( i == num_cals )
|
|
{
|
|
COMEDILIB_DEBUG( 3, "failed to find matching calibration\n" );
|
|
return -1;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return i;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
static int set_calibration( comedi_t *dev, struct calibration_file_contents *parsed_file,
|
|
unsigned int cal_index )
|
|
{
|
|
int i, retval, num_caldacs;
|
|
|
|
num_caldacs = parsed_file->calibrations[ cal_index ].num_caldacs;
|
|
COMEDILIB_DEBUG( 4, "num_caldacs %i\n", num_caldacs );
|
|
|
|
for( i = 0; i < num_caldacs; i++ )
|
|
{
|
|
struct caldac_setting caldac;
|
|
|
|
caldac = parsed_file->calibrations[ cal_index ].caldacs[ i ];
|
|
COMEDILIB_DEBUG( 4, "subdev %i, ch %i, val %i\n", caldac.subdevice,
|
|
caldac.channel,caldac.value);
|
|
retval = comedi_data_write( dev, caldac.subdevice, caldac.channel,
|
|
0, 0, caldac.value );
|
|
if( retval < 0 ) return retval;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return 0;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
EXPORT_SYMBOL(comedi_apply_calibration,0.7.20);
|
|
int comedi_apply_calibration( comedi_t *dev, unsigned int subdev, unsigned int channel,
|
|
unsigned int range, unsigned int aref, const char *cal_file_path )
|
|
{
|
|
struct stat file_stats;
|
|
char file_path[ 1024 ];
|
|
int retval;
|
|
int cal_index;
|
|
FILE *cal_file;
|
|
struct calibration_file_contents *parsed_file;
|
|
|
|
if( cal_file_path )
|
|
{
|
|
strncpy( file_path, cal_file_path, sizeof( file_path ) );
|
|
}else
|
|
{
|
|
if( fstat( comedi_fileno( dev ), &file_stats ) < 0 )
|
|
{
|
|
COMEDILIB_DEBUG( 3, "failed to get file stats of comedi device file\n" );
|
|
return -1;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
snprintf( file_path, sizeof( file_path ), "/etc/comedi/calibrations/%s_0x%lx",
|
|
comedi_get_board_name( dev ),
|
|
( unsigned long ) file_stats.st_ino );
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
cal_file = fopen( file_path, "r" );
|
|
if( cal_file == NULL )
|
|
{
|
|
COMEDILIB_DEBUG( 3, "failed to open file\n" );
|
|
return -1;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
parsed_file = parse_calibration_file( cal_file );
|
|
if( parsed_file == NULL )
|
|
{
|
|
COMEDILIB_DEBUG( 3, "failed to parse calibration file\n" );
|
|
return -1;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
fclose( cal_file );
|
|
|
|
retval = check_cal_file( dev, parsed_file );
|
|
if( retval < 0 )
|
|
{
|
|
cleanup_calibration_parse( parsed_file );
|
|
return retval;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
cal_index = find_calibration( parsed_file, subdev, channel, range, aref );
|
|
if( cal_index < 0 )
|
|
{
|
|
cleanup_calibration_parse( parsed_file );
|
|
return cal_index;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
retval = set_calibration( dev, parsed_file, cal_index );
|
|
if( retval < 0 )
|
|
{
|
|
cleanup_calibration_parse( parsed_file );
|
|
return retval;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return 0;
|
|
}
